Relax and Read Book Club: Meet Me at the Seaside Cottages by Jenny Colgan

Discover this month's poolside read from our Relax and Read Book Club - Meet Me at the Seaside Cottages by Jenny Colgan.

Spabreaks.com’s Relax and Read Book Club gives you the chance to discover new books, learn about the authors, share your opinions and really escape into an inspiring world of literature.

This month we're reading Meet Me at the Seaside Cottages by Jenny Colgan, a story about Janey Carter who lives by the sea in Carso, and how she navigates life when her 30 year old daughter Essie comes home after losing her job. It explores the challenges of mother and daughter living back under the same roof, and leaves space for life to happen when you least expect it.

"The story of a mother and daughter who find their love and to each other, fabulous characters that make you laugh and sigh...and as for the dogs, they are the icing on the cake." - Amazon review

Meet Me at the Seaside Cottages - give us your best holiday pitch. What's the story, who is it for, and why is it the perfect spa break companion?

This book is for anyone who loves going through Rightmove and peering into other people's houses and lives - it's for property nosey parkers. Janey is divorced and finally has her life back on track, when her adult daughter moves back in due to the horrendous property market- and complications ensue. There's also dogs, laughs and sunshine.
